12 sexual harassment
HRa form of discrimination through the unwelcome and unwanted sexual conduct of one employee toward another. Most of the victims of sexual harassment are women, and the most common forms are physical, verbal, suggestive gesturing, written messages, graphic or pictorial displays, or the emotional isolation of an individual. The effective promotion of a policy to protect employees and customers from such harassment is good organizational practice. -
